Warning Signs You Need Under-Cabinet Water Extraction
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show moisture buildup under your cabinets.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s time to call us.
Warped or Discolored Cabinets
Water damage can cause cabinets to warp or discolor.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your cabinets, it’s essential to act quickly.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ains can show a more significant problem under your cabinets. If you notice any water stains, don’t hesitate to call us.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old and mildew growth can be a health risk and show a moisture issue under your cabinets. If you notice any mold or mildew growth, call us immediately.
Water-Damaged Flooring
Water damage can cause flooring to buckle, warp, or become discolored. If you notice any water damage to your flooring, call us to prevent further damage.
Increased Humidity
Increased humidity can show a moisture issue under your cabinets. If you notice a significant increase in humidity, call us to prevent further damage.
Under-Cabinet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ill under cabinets | Yes | No | You can likely clean up the spill yourself and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age under cabinets with m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ew growth can be a health risk and need professional attention. |
| Water damage under cabinets with extensive warping or discoloration | No | Yes | Extensive warping or discoloration can show a significant moisture issue that needs professional attention. |
| Water damage under cabinets with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can cause further damage and need professional attention to prevent long-term damage. |
| Water damage under cabinets with a strong, unpleasant odor | No | Yes | A strong, unpleasant odor can show a moisture issue that needs professional attention. |
| Water damage under cabinets with water stains on ceilings or walls | No | Yes | Water stains can show a more significant problem under your cabinets that needs professional attention. |

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ost in Elfrida, AZ
The cost of under-cabinet water extraction in Elfrida, AZ can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average prices and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water and equipment needed |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and equipment needed |
| Final inspection and cleanup |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
